Most often, they refer to the same solution: an auxiliary air suspension system supports the vehicle's standard suspension by using air bellows between the axle and the chassis.

Advantages of an auxiliary air suspension

✔ Vehicle remains level when loaded

✔ Increased driving comfort

✔ Improved driving stability

✔ Reduced body roll

✔ Relief for leaf or coil springs

✔ Ideal for motorhomes, vans, and pickups

Reinforcement springs increase the vehicle's load capacity and prevent sagging under heavy loads.

Advantages of reinforcement springs

✔ Permanent reinforcement of the chassis

✔ Maintenance-free

✔ Higher stability

✔ Less sway

✔ Ideal for consistently heavy loads

A lift kit increases the vehicle's ground clearance and improves its off-road capability.

Advantages of a lift kit

✔ More ground clearance

✔ Better approach/departure angle

✔ Space for larger tires

✔ Improved off-road capabilities

✔ More attractive appearance

What is better: auxiliary air spring or reinforcement spring?

Auxiliary air springs offer more adjustment options and comfort. Reinforcement springs are maintenance-free and particularly suitable for consistently heavy loads.

Can I retrofit an auxiliary air suspension?

Yes, retrofit systems are available for many motorhomes, vans, pickups, and commercial vehicles.

When is a lift kit worthwhile?

A lift kit is particularly worthwhile for SUVs, pickups, and adventure vehicles if more ground clearance or larger tires are desired.

Is suspension reinforcement useful for a motorhome?

Yes, especially with heavy loads, suspension reinforcement improves driving stability, comfort, and safety.

Which suspension solution is suitable for vans and motorhomes?

For motorhomes and vans, auxiliary air springs or reinforcement springs are often used. They improve driving comfort, stability, payload, and safety, and prevent the vehicle from sagging under heavy loads.
